Automotive ECUs and DCUs Market Analysis and Latest Trends

Automotive ECUs (Electronic Control Units) and DCUs (Domain Control Units) are key components in modern vehicles that control and manage various systems. ECUs are responsible for controlling functions like engine management, braking, and steering, while DCUs integrate multiple ECUs to ensure efficient communication and coordination between different vehicle domains, such as powertrain, body control, and infotainment.

One of the key trends in the market is the shift towards highly integrated domain controllers that can handle multiple functions, reducing complexity and cost. These domain controllers offer enhanced processing power and memory capabilities, enabling advanced ADAS features and autonomous driving functionalities.

Another trend is the growing focus on electric and hybrid vehicles. As the adoption of EVs increases worldwide, the demand for ECUs and DCUs specifically designed for electric powertrains is also rising. These specialized ECUs and DCUs are crucial for managing battery systems, motor control, and power distribution in electric vehicles.

Furthermore, the market is witnessing the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) technologies into ECUs and DCUs. AI and ML enable the development of adaptive and self-learning systems that can optimize vehicle performance, enhance safety, and enable predictive maintenance.
